FSCS to run nine month levy year to prevent advisers overpaying

Compensation levy year from July 2018 to March 2019

The regulator has proposed the Financial Services Compensation Scheme (FSCS) should run a shortened compensation levy year in 2018/2019 to prevent advisers overpaying for the lifeboat fund.

The changes are being made because the FSCS' compensation levy year currently runs from 1 July to 30 June, but the separate management expenses levy, which firms pay at the same time, is calculated in line with the financial year - from 1 April to 31 March. The Financial Conduct Authority (FCA) said it has decided to align both with the financial year because the current situation makes it more complicated for the lifeboat fund to forecast levies and makes it difficult for firms to budget.
